      They dilated me before trying the contact lenses and only tested them for distance, so it wan't until I got home that I realized I couldn't read with them. When I went in after the weekend for them to check, the doctor just had me try three different lenses, each giving better reading but worse distance vision, then he left. I complained to the assistant, who ordered a multifocal lens to try. While I waited for the order to arrive, they sent me a bill because they had undercharged my insurance copay at the visit. Then, they called to tell me to pick up the lens any day they were open. I went to the Bonita Springs office on Tuesday to pick it up and found it closed, even though their website says open M-F. I went again Thursday, and they said I had to make an appointment for a follow-up fitting. So far it has been a nightmare.

      I originally visited this office in October 2022 for my annual exam. Sample contacts were ordered based on the script. Several attempts to make contact regarding the status of the original samples went unanswered. When the samples finally arrived it was realized they documented the incorrect script, through either an honest mistake or complete incompetence a + was inadvertently used instead of a in documentation. The correct sample pair was not received until after Christmas. I requested a copy of my prescription in order to have them supplied by another vendor and for the second time they provided me the incorrect prescription. I have now spent hundreds of dollars, and nearly 6 months working to get correct prescription and contacts. All Saints eye care has not only demonstrated incompetence in the field of ophthalmology but a general disregard for customer service.
